When it comes to marketing your powder coating and paint company, there are a variety of strategies you can use to promote your products and services. One strategy that is becoming increasingly popular is the use of 360 virtual tours.

360 virtual tours allow potential customers to take a virtual tour of your facility, showcasing your products, services, and capabilities. This technology can be particularly useful for powder coating and paint companies, as it allows potential customers to see your facilities and equipment in action, and get a better understanding of your processes and capabilities.

Here are some tips for using 360 virtual tours to market your powder coating and paint company:

  1. Showcase your facilities: A 360 virtual tour allows you to showcase your facilities in a way that traditional photos and videos cannot. You can take potential customers on a virtual tour of your entire facility, including your equipment, workspaces, and storage areas. This can help build trust and credibility with potential customers, as they can see for themselves the quality of your facilities.
  2. Highlight your services: In addition to showcasing your facilities, a 360 virtual tour can also be used to highlight your services. For example, you can use the tour to show potential customers how you prep surfaces for powder coating or how you apply different types of paint finishes. This can help potential customers understand the quality of your services and differentiate you from competitors.
  3. Provide product demonstrations: Another great use of 360 virtual tours is to provide product demonstrations. For example, if you have a new type of powder coating or paint, you can use the tour to show potential customers how it works and what the final product looks like. This can help generate interest and excitement around your products.
  4. Make it interactive: A 360 virtual tour can be made even more engaging by adding interactive elements. For example, you can add hotspots to the tour that provide more information about specific pieces of equipment or processes. You can also add clickable buttons that allow potential customers to request a quote or schedule a consultation.
  5. Use it on your website and social media: Once you’ve created your 360 virtual tour, it’s important to use it in as many places as possible. Be sure to embed the tour on your website and share it on your social media channels. This will help drive traffic to your website and increase engagement with potential customers.

In conclusion, using 360 virtual tours to market your powder coating and paint company is a great way to showcase your facilities, highlight your services, and differentiate yourself from competitors. By providing potential customers with a virtual tour of your facility, you can help build trust and credibility, generate excitement around your products, and ultimately drive more sales.
